New brand marks Salboy’s entry into hospitality market to cater to rising demand
Manchester, 24 April 2026 – A boutique aparthotel brand has launched into the UK hospitality market, to meet rising demand for holiday experiences that combine the independence and privacy of an apartment with the ease of a hotel.
The Hidden brand is launched by Salboy, the nationwide property development and finance group. Hidden St Ives, the brand’s first destination, is located in the heart of the famous Cornish coastal town and will open the doors to its first guests in mid-May.

St Ives is the first in a number of Hidden projects in development in popular tourist destinations throughout the UK, including London and Manchester. All Hidden aparthotels are developed by Salboy in partnership with local contractors, and will be managed by established hospitality operators with decades’ of local experience.
Surrounded by fields, rugged headland and coastal walks including the famous coastal path, Hidden St Ives has been developed on the site of a former hillside hotel a ten minute walk from the centre of the famous Cornish town. Hidden St Ives offers 18 two-bedroom apartments, each of which is built to its own bespoke interior design plan, creating a distinct sense of individuality between them all. 16 apartments are equipped with private terraces with coastal views and over half have outdoor hot tubs. Guests also benefit from an elevated level of service from the on-site management team. A 24-hour concierge will meet guests upon arrival; housekeeping services are operated at hotel-level frequency; and a local chauffeur service is available for journeys to the town’s restaurants, beaches, galleries and shops.

The creation of Hidden within the wider Salboy Group follows the launch of Salboy Construction earlier in 2026 and the Salboy Property Development Roadshow programme in March. The Salboy Group now counts more than six active property and construction brands under its wider umbrella.
